 HD74HC682/HD74HC684
8-bit Magnitude Comparator
Description
These magnitude comparators perform comparisons of two eight-bit binary or BCD words. All types provide P=Q outputs and provide P>Q outputs. The HD74HC682 features 20 k pullup termination resistors on the Q inputs for analog or switch data.

Features
* * * * * High Speed Operation High Output Current: Fanout of 10 LSTTL Loads Wide Operating Voltage: VCC = 2 to 6 V Low Input Current: 1 A max Low Quiescent Supply Current: ICC (static) = 4 A max (Ta = 25C)
